根据RFC 4122标准,UUID的第9个字节(索引为8)的最高两位定义了其变体。
版本更新日志:关注PHP团队发布的安全更新和新功能,比如2025年3月发布的PHP 8.4.5就是一次重要安全更新,了解这些能保证你的知识不过时。
#include <iostream> #include <string> #include <cstdlib> // For atoi std::string str_c = "789"; int num_c = std::atoi(str_c.c_str()); // 需要转换为 C 风格字符串 std::cout << "atoi(\"" << str_c << "\"): " << num_c << std::endl; // 输出: 789 // 示例:包含非数字字符的字符串 std::string str_c_bad = "123xyz"; int num_c_bad = std::atoi(str_c_bad.c_str()); std::cout << "atoi(\"" << str_c_bad << "\"): " << num_c_bad << std::endl; // 输出: 123 // 示例:完全非数字的字符串 std::string str_c_invalid = "hello"; int num_c_invalid = std::atoi(str_c_invalid.c_str()); std::cout << "atoi(\"" << str_c_invalid << "\"): " << num_c_invalid << std::endl; // 输出: 0atoi 的主要缺点是它不提供任何错误检查机制。
类型统一: 遍历DataFrame的每一列。
当条件为True时,保留原始值;当条件为False时,替换为指定值(默认为NaN)。
此方法适用于日期和时间格式始终一致的情况。
# 假设一个失败任务的UUID为 123e4567-e89b-12d3-a456-426614174000 php artisan queue:forget 123e4567-e89b-12d3-a456-426614174000 注意事项与最佳实践 队列连接类型: 上述讨论主要适用于QUEUE_CONNECTION=database的场景。
如何优化XML解析性能?
再来是资源利用率与轻量级。
注意:实际应用中,你需要确保能正确获取订单ID。
在每个可能出错的步骤中都应该检查错误,并采取适当的措施。
C++中字符串转整数有多种方法:std::stoi适用于C++11及以上,需异常处理;stringstream类型安全且兼容旧标准;atoi简单但不安全,错误难检测;std::from_chars(C++17)性能高、无异常,推荐现代项目使用。
如果 overrides 不存在,或者 overrides.source 不存在,或者 overrides.source.property 不存在,由于 ChainableUndefined 的作用,overrides.source.property 表达式会评估为一个“未定义”对象。
定义和解析模板 你可以通过字符串或文件来定义模板内容。
在大多数需要确保参数存在的场景中,isset()是更直接的选择。
总结 通过 getTimestampFromQuarter 函数,PHP开发者可以轻松、准确地获取任何指定季度的起始或结束Unix时间戳,有效解决了日期时间计算中的常见难题。
application/x-www-form-urlencoded: 这是HTML表单默认的Content-Type。
run 方法: 使用 subprocess.run 执行给定的命令。
Go中判断系统调用错误需先检查error是否为nil,若非nil则通过errors.Is或类型断言分析具体错误,必要时可使用syscall.Errno获取底层错误码。
基本上就这些。
本文链接:http://www.asphillseesit.com/359110_50320f.html